   <dc:description>Background: Diving is a popular recreational sport on the Spanish coast. Despite the safety&#xd;
measures, deaths related to this activity are frequently reported. PBt/AGE has been described&#xd;
as the cause of death in SCUBA divers in 13-24% of the cases. The main impediment in the&#xd;
diagnosis of PBt/AGE is the existence of entities that can mask it and divert the cause of death,&#xd;
especially putrefaction. Studies have delved into this field to reinforce macroscopic autopsy,&#xd;
imaging, and gas analysis techniques. Microscopic studies have fallen short in refining the&#xd;
diagnoses. Therefore, we propose the histomorphometric analysis of lung tissue to provide&#xd;
objective quantitative data and more reliable information for the diagnoses of PBt/AGE and&#xd;
its differentiation from putrefaction.&#xd;
Objectives: To describe and quantify the histomorphological changes observed in lung tissue&#xd;
samples for the differential diagnosis between pulmonary barotrauma in deaths due to&#xd;
SCUBA diving and taphonomic lung damage secondary to putrefaction.&#xd;
Design: Cross sectional and descriptive study to be performed in Girona from 2020-2021.&#xd;
Population: The study population will be divided in three groups: 1) Divers deaths from&#xd;
PBt/AGE, 2) Non-diving-related deaths and in an emphysematous evolutionary period, and 3)&#xd;
Non-diving-related deaths with low probability of putrefaction. All samples will be obtained&#xd;
from the Forensic Pathology Service of the Legal Medicine and Forensic Sciences Institute of&#xd;
Catalonia.&#xd;
Methods: Pulmonary histological preparations will be sampled and analysed. The&#xd;
histomorphometric analysis will be done through a FIJI ImageJ2 (National Institutes of Health)&#xd;
image analysis programme</dc:description>
